Atkinson-Shiffrin Theory

A model of memory proposed by Richard Atkinson and Richard Shiffrin that describes human memory as having three key stages: sensory memory, short-term memory, and long-term memory.

Short-term Memory

The capacity for holding a small amount of information in an active, readily available state for a short period of time.

Sensory Memory

The shortest-term element of memory, it's the ability to retain impressions of sensory information after the original stimuli have ended, acting almost as a buffer for stimuli through the senses.
